Tacquet (crater)

From TheBestLinks.com

General Characteristics
Latitude 16.6° N
Longitude 19.2° E
Diameter 6.9 km
Depth 1.3 km
Selenographic Colongitude 340° at sunrise
Name Source André Tacquet

Tacquet is a small, bowl-shaped crater that lies near the south edge of Mare Serenitatis, in the northeast part of the Moon. The surface near the crater is marked by high albedo ejecta. To the west is a system of rilles designated the Rimae Menelaus.

Associated Craters:

By convention these features are identified on Lunar maps by placing the letter on the side of the crater mid-point that is closest to Tacquet crater.


Tacquet Latitude Longitude Diameter
B 15.8° N 20.0° E 14 km
C 13.5° N 21.1° E 6 km
